2 Samoan suspects carry out fatal shooting in Ho Chi Minh City under orders from overseas

The two Samoan suspects involved in a fatal shooting targeting foreigners in downtown Ho Chi Minh City last week have confessed to the crime, saying they acted under instructions from an individual based overseas.

Lieutenant General Mai Hoang, director of the Ho Chi Minh City Department of Public Security, on Tuesday chaired a press briefing to announce the initial results of a probe into the suspected murder case that occurred on the evening of May 21.

The Ministry of Public Security said on Monday that its officers teamed up with Ho Chi Minh City police arrested two suspects, who are Samoan nationals, linked to the shooting attack that left one foreigner dead and another injured in downtown Ho Chi Minh City.

The briefing was attended by Lieutenant Colonel Nguyen Thanh Hung, deputy director of the department and head of the municipal police investigation agency, along with representatives from the Ministry of Public Security’s Criminal Police Department and Drug Crime Investigation Department, police in neighboring Tay Ninh Province, and other related units.

Under the decisive and timely direction of leaders of the Ministry of Public Security, and with support and coordination from the ministry’s departments and local police forces, officers swiftly apprehended the two suspects involved in the fatal shooting despite the pair’s highly professional methods, violent behavior, and use of military-grade weapons.

The suspects were reportedly prepared to resist arrest if detected.

Acting with determination and tactical coordination to prevent further attacks threatening public safety, the joint task force captured the two foreigners while they were hiding near the Vietnam-Cambodia border less than 72 hours after the shooting happened.

Both men were safely escorted to the headquarters of the investigative police agency under the municipal department.

During the questioning, the duo admitted to opening fire under the directive from an individual based overseas.

Investigators said the two men entered Ho Chi Minh City through Tan Son Nhat International Airport on May 14 and spent several days monitoring the movements of the two victims.

On the evening of May 21, they opened fire with three shots after the victims and their friends had finished dining at Cee’f Restaurant in downtown Ben Thanh Ward.

Based on collected evidence, officers in the southern metropolis issued emergency detention orders against the two Samoans, identified as Vaa Vaa and Tafia Steve, for further investigation on charges of murder.

Authorities also issued emergency detention orders against Nguyen Trong Nghia, 24, a passenger transport driver operating on the Ho Chi Minh City-Tay Ninh route, and seven other Vietnamese nationals suspected of failing to report the crime and assisting the two suspects in their attempt to flee.

Police said the investigation is being expanded and that all individuals connected to the case will be dealt with strictly in accordance with the law.
